ACC-Toronto Section 2009 AGM
Our AGM will feature a new play about Conrad Kain, one of Canada's most famous alpinists. Kain's significant first ascents in the Canadian Rockies include Bugaboo Spire, Mount Louis and Mount Robson. We are fortunate to have a new play about his life at our AGM.
Cash bar at 6 PM, a short meeting starting at 7 PM, and then the show starts immediately afterwards. Join us for the meeting and the show.
